Each database has an associated database identifier, which is a numerical value in the range1 to , and a database name, which is a character value with a maximum of 16characters. The Associator system file contains internal storage information that manages the data for the entire database. The Work Storage system file contains temporary work files. Output 2. The data fields are the vertical columnsof data.
|Published (Last):||7 January 2009|
|PDF File Size:||15.12 Mb|
|ePub File Size:||6.79 Mb|
|Price:||Free* [*Free Regsitration Required]|
Fegis The companies commonly use Mainframe for critical financial applications or for public use complex systems.
Programming on the Mainframe class computers is not a popular profession nowadays, it can be however an interesting one and also very profitable. Currently, essentia,s largest manufacturer of adqbas is IBM, but we should keep in mind that this is not the only provider of this type of technology. Also the language is extremely easy to learn and essentkals. If you see any errors in my articles, please let me know!
Get updates Get updates. Programming languages on the mainframe As you can guess, to program Mainframe machines we usually use languages specially adapted for this. Each database has an associated database identifierwhich is a numerical value in the range 1 to 65, and a database namewhich is a character value with a maximum of 16 characters. Intro — a few words of introduction The data fields are the vertical columns of data.
The logical records are the horizontal rows of data. In this first post I will give you some information about the mainframe computer as well as the language and database that we will use. Soon we will also start writing the first programs and create our own databases. This is why I decided to start this tutorial for anyone essejtials would like to know more about this interesting area of computer science, and also learn a little of NATURAL language, which is one of the programming languages used for Mainframe computers.
If you like the article and you believe there should be more articles about Mainframes please clap a bitleave a comment or share this link wherever you want. The following output illustrates four data fields and seven logical records from an ADABAS file containing data about customers.
Mainframes in general are used when the reliability of the unit and high performance of the processor are key to business needs. Data fields with a level of 2 or greater are considered to be a part of the immediately preceding group, which has a lower level number.
It was usually large, like most computers then, and it occupied a large part of the server rooms. The extraordinary advantage of Mainframe systems is essenntials they can be joined to form one logical super-unit. The Work Storage system file contains temporary work files. You can find all the parts of this tutorial in the links below:. Each database can consist of up to 5, logical files. Transferring this type of application to more modern solutions is not only very difficult, but also extremely expensive.
You can find all the parts of this tutorial in the links below: The first character must be alphabetic, and the second character can be either alphabetic or numeric. The latter is the language that I use at work and the one that I use writing this tutorial.
Level Number A data field level number is a one- or two-digit number, from 01 to 07, used in conjunction with data field grouping. An ISN is the logical identifier for each record.
To avoid confusion, keep in mind the two usages of the term descriptor throughout this document: Systems based on Mainframes are still widely used, mainly by large organizations. Each database can consist of up to 5, logical files, depending on the device type. A data field level number is a one- or two-digit number, from 01 to 07, used in conjunction with data field grouping.
In the next part of the tutorial we will learn about the syntax of the language and write our first program. Never miss a story from codeburstwhen you sign up for Medium. Intro — a few words of introduction The Associator system file contains internal storage information that manages the data for the entire database.
Well, there are many reasons. Previous Page Next Page. The name Mainframe refers to the first machines of this type. TOP Related Posts.
The logical records are the horizontal rows of data. The following output illustrates four data fields and seven logical records from an ADABAS file containing data about customers. Currently, the largest manufacturer of mainframe is IBM, but we should keep in mind that this is not the only provider of this type of technology. When I was preparing to start my job as a junior mainframe developer, I encountered the problem of a small amount of knowledge sources in this area, particularly available for free online.
ADABAS ESSENTIALS PDF
Security is available through password protection and by maintaining data in enciphered form. A user password specifies the authority for the data field, and ADABAS automatically determines whether the user is authorized to perform the requested operation. In this case, the password specifies value restrictions on logical records to be selected, read, and updated. You must supply this cipher code in order to access the enciphered data. You can restrict the use of whole application systems, individual programs and functions, and the access to DDMs.